It can be seen that the results corresponding to each load form a part of the classical Stribeck curve with a continuous transition between the results corresponding to the lubricants of different
viscosity. At high values of Uη, the dependence of the friction
coefficient on Uη appears approximately linear on the log–log plot which indicates that the contact operates in the hydrodynamic
lubrication regime. At low values of Uη, the contact operates in the mixed lubrication regime and the friction coefficient increases
with decreasing Uη.
